SPECIAL CLAIM 1920-6: SUBMITTED BY JUDY SHAVER IN THE AMOUNT OF $1,500.00 FOR DAMAGE TO THE INTERIOR OF HER HOME AT 213 OLDE BROOK COURT AS A RESULT OF A SEWER LINE BACK-UP.

BACKGROUND: A claim was filed by Judy Shaver for expenses incurred due to a sewer main back-up at her home on May 21, 2019, at 213 Olde Brook Court. Ms. Shaver requests reimbursement of her out-of-pocket insurance deductible in the amount of $1,500.00.
On September 3, 2019, an Executive Session was held to discuss the claims being submitted on behalf of three property owners regarding the sewer back-up on Olde Brook Court. This claim is being submitted to City Council for consideration at this time.
DISCUSSION: On the morning of May 21, 2019, City division staff received service calls for a possible sewer obstruction from residents of Olde Brook Court. Upon arrival, staff inspected the 8-inch clay sewer main and found it was obstructed. As a result, three property owners submitted claims to the City requesting payment of their damages.
The claim was investigated by David Hager, Utilities Manager. According to City maintenance records for the past three years, the City has never received a maintenance request for the Olde Brook Court area. When the City received news of the sewer back-up, it took immediate action and cleared the obstruction on the same day.
As previously discussed with Council, this is not a clear case of City liability, however there could be potential liability on the City. Mrs. Shaver’s claim in the amount of $1,500 appears reasonable.
RECOMMENDATION: Based upon the above and foregoing, it is the recommendation of the City Attorney’s Office that the claim of Judy Shaver, in the amount of $1,500.00 as set forth above, be approved.
